If you're a fan of offbeat comedies and rock ‘n' roll, then “Free LSD” is the film you need to put on your watchlist this summer. Directed by OFF!'s frontman Dimitri Coats, making his feature directorial debut, this wacky sci-fi adventure dives headfirst into the multiverse with a punk rock twist.

The film centers around Keith, played by the legendary Keith Morris, who also fronts the band OFF!. Keith is an elderly sex shop owner who falls for a younger woman, sparking a chain of events that leads him to an experimental erectile dysfunction doctor. This isn't just any ordinary treatment; it opens the door to an alternate reality where Keith's band, OFF!, becomes the target of an advanced AI species determined to stop their music from awakening human consciousness.

Joining Morris in this eclectic cast are Autry Fulbright II, DH Peligro, Chelsea Debo, David Yow, James Duval, Barry Del Sherman, Dana Gould, Chris D., Chloe Dykstra, and a special appearance by Jack Black, who adds his signature comedic flair. “Free LSD” had its premiere at the 2023 Slamdance Film Festival and is set to hit VOD on August 9th, 2024. But if you're lucky enough to catch one of OFF!'s final shows, you might get to see the film in theaters, complete with a Q&A and other surprises. The band will be touring across California, New York, Chicago, Philadelphia, Oakland, and Boston throughout July, giving fans a last chance to experience their energetic performances live.

Produced by Kurt Kittleson with co-producer Gill Gayle and executive producer Anthony Kiedis, “Free LSD” is not just a film but an experience.
